Transaction 790c2dea8ca63e2d22525bacf92ac16c6655230608fe0c045037612806a47210

1 Input
1 Outputs
  • 790c2dea8ca63e2d22525bacf92ac16c6655230608fe0c045037612806a47210:0
  • value  2087070
    address  3Bv2dudttffdJV76f91AM44GqyDJsgsrmK